ERROR_VDM_HARD_ERROR が発生すると、特にワークフローが中断される場合、非常にイライラすることがあります。コード 593 (0x251) に関連するこの特定の Windows システム エラーは、通常、16 ビット アプリケーションの実行に必要なコンポーネントである NTVDM (NT 仮想 DOS マシン) に問題が発生した場合に発生します。一般的なトリガーには、互換性の競合、ユーザー環境変数の誤った構成、レジストリ エントリの誤り、アプリケーションのインストールに関する問題などがあります。
付随するメッセージには、「NTVDM でハード エラーが発生しました」と表示され、解決が必要なより深刻な問題を示しています。解決策に進む前に、いくつかの予備チェックを実行することを検討してください。コンピューターを再起動し、Windows とソフトウェアが最新であることを確認し、影響を受けるアプリケーションをフル スクリーン モードからウィンドウ モードに切り替えます。これらのシンプルでありながら効果的な対策により、多くの場合、それ以上介入することなく問題を解決できます。
Windows で ERROR_VDM_HARD_ERROR を修正するにはどうすればいいですか?
1. 影響を受けるアプリケーションを互換モードで実行する
- 問題のあるアプリケーションの実行可能ファイル (.exe ファイル) を右クリックし、[プロパティ]を選択します。
- [互換性] タブに移動します。 [互換モードでこのプログラムを実行する]というチェックボックスをオンにし、ドロップダウン メニューから以前のバージョンの Windows を選択します。
- 「適用」をクリックし、「OK」をクリックして変更を保存します。アプリケーションをテストして、エラーが引き続き発生するかどうかを確認します。
- ERROR_VDM_HARD_ERROR が残る場合は、互換性のために別の古いバージョンの Windows を試してください。
2. ユーザー環境変数を再構成する
- Windows+ を押して検索機能を開きますS。「システムの詳細設定を表示」と入力し、関連する結果を選択します。
- [詳細設定]タブに移動し、[環境変数]をクリックします。
- TEMP変数をダブルクリックし、値をC:\TEMPに更新します。[OK]をクリックします。
- TMP変数に対しても同じプロセスを繰り返し、 C:\TEMPに設定します。
- 最後に、コンピューターを再起動して、エラーが解決されたかどうかを確認します。
この手順では、特に Windows Server で ERROR_VDM_HARD_ERROR の一般的な原因である無効なユーザー環境変数に関連する問題に対処できます。このアプローチは、この問題に直面しているユーザーの 60% に効果がありました。
3. Windowsレジストリを検査する
- Windows+ を押してR実行ダイアログを起動し、regeditと入力して を押しますEnter。
- UAC プロンプトが表示されたら、[はい]をクリックして確認します。
- レジストリ エディターで、アドレス バーに次のパスを入力して、を押しますEnter。
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\VirtualDeviceDrivers
- VDDキーを見つけて、不足している DLL を参照するエントリを確認します。
- 問題のあるエントリが見つかった場合は、それらを 1 つずつ右クリックし、[削除]を選択して確認します。
レジストリ関連のエラーは、アンインストールされたソフトウェアの残骸から発生することがよくあります。プログラムの残骸を完全に削除し、レジストリの肥大化を防ぐために、信頼できるソフトウェア アンインストーラーの使用を検討してください。
4. アプリケーションを再インストールする
- Windows+ を押してR実行ダイアログを開き、appwiz.cplと入力して を押しますEnter。
- システム エラーの原因となっているアプリケーションをリストから探して選択し、[アンインストール]をクリックします。
- 指示に従ってアンインストールし、完了したらマシンを再起動します。
- 公式開発者サイトからアプリケーションを再インストールし、状況が改善するかどうかを確認します。
5. 最後の手段としてWindowsを再インストールする
他の方法がすべて失敗した場合、Windows を再インストールすることが最終的な解決策となる可能性があります。続行する前に、損失を防ぐためにすべての重要なデータを外部デバイスにバックアップしてください。
Windows を再インストールするには、フォーマット済みの USB ドライブをコンピューターに接続し、Microsoft の公式ページにアクセスしてメディア作成ツールをダウンロードし、それを使用して起動可能な USB ドライブを作成します。USB から起動するように BIOS 設定を調整し、Windows セットアップを起動して、インストール プロセスを実行します。
新規インストール後も ERROR_VDM_HARD_ERROR が続く場合は、アプリ自体に固有の問題がある可能性もあるため、サポートに連絡するのが最善策です。
ご質問がある場合、またはご自身のケースでどのアプローチが効果的だったかを共有したい場合は、お気軽に下記にコメントを残してください。
よくある質問
1. ERROR_VDM_HARD_ERROR はどういう意味ですか?
ERROR_VDM_HARD_ERROR は、NTVDM (NT 仮想 DOS マシン) が Windows 環境で 16 ビット アプリケーションを実行しようとしたときに重大なエラーが発生したことを示します。
2. 今後 ERROR_VDM_HARD_ERROR を防ぐにはどうすればよいですか?
このエラーを防ぐには、互換性のあるアプリケーションを使用し、Windows システムを定期的に更新し、ユーザー環境変数とレジストリ設定を慎重に管理してください。
3. Windows を再インストールするとファイルは消去されますか?
バックアップせずに Windows を完全に再インストールすると、システム上のすべてのファイルが失われる恐れがあります。再インストールを進める前に、必ず重要なデータを外部ストレージ ドライブにバックアップしてください。
コメントを残す